Madame de Maillé

A portrait of Madeleine Angélique Charlotte de Bréhant, duchesse de Maillé, by Joseph Duplessis. Via Vive le Reine. The Duchesse de Maillé was one of Marie-Antoinette's ladies, a dame du palais. Her husband served the Comte d'Artois. The Duchesse showed great courage by staying at the Queen's side throughout the attacks on the palace until separated by imprisonment in August 1792. She escaped the guillotine only through the death of Robespierre, and lived to see the Restoration, dying in 1819. (More here.) Share
